  • A groundbreaking study from the University of Birmingham reveals that a mutation in the CEBPA gene accelerates the progression of myelodysplastic syndromes (MDS) to acute myeloid leukemia (AML). By creating a lab model with patient-derived stem cells, researchers have captured the disease's traits and resistance to treatment, paving the way for advancements in MDS diagnosis and therapy.
